AGENCY: Salt Lake City (Utah). Police Department
SERIES: 16422
TITLE: Criminal history name file
DATES: 1920-
ARRANGEMENT: Chronological
DESCRIPTION: This automated system contains a record of arrests accessable by name for each individual with a police record. This system includes information concerning civil service applicants, taxicab drivers, solicitors, locksmiths, licensed club dancers, or all those required to be fingerprinted. This information includes: name, aliases if any, social security number, date of birth, dates of arrest, and type of arrest. This information is purged 90 years after date of birth, every 10 years in 10 year increments. The system is stored on hard disk and is backed up on tape every two weeks.
